About Jhiriya Bajpein Tola Village

Jhiriya Bajpein Tola is a mid sized village in Amarpatan tehsil, in the district of Satna, Madhya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 667, made up of 357 males and 310 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 868 females per 1000 males. The village covers 161.15 hectares hectares.
